Airbnb CEO Brian Chesky has had sufficient of merely being a synthetic intelligence kingmaker. He now plans to again a brand new AI lab of his personal. The information, damaged by Bloomberg and confirmed to Trendster by an individual accustomed to the scenario, marks Chesky as considered one of many Silicon Valley machers who’re unhappy with the fashions popping out of the frontier labs.

Whereas Airbnb has adopted AI coding instruments, Chesky mentioned final yr it hasn’t struck an LLM partnership as a result of present merchandise weren’t fairly prepared.

Nonetheless, Chesky has loads of perception. He met Sam Altman in 2006 by way of Y Combinator, which incubated Airbnb, and stayed in contact. When OpenAI took off, he started assembly often with Altman to supply recommendation about managing a hypergrowth tech firm.

Chesky, who was reportedly thought of a possible OpenAI board member, helped dealer Altman’s return to energy after its board of administrators fired the CEO for lack of candor. Chesky suggested Altman on public relations and rallied help for him amongst Silicon Valley bigwigs.

Now, nevertheless, he seems to be getting into competitors along with his mentee’s firm.

It’s not clear what the main target of Chesky’s new AI lab will probably be, though the Bloomberg article mentions person interplay and design, areas that he has emphasised at Airbnb.

That’s not in contrast to what Brett Adcock is doing at Hark, the AI lab he launched late final yr to develop a novel person interface for an AI assistant, though the startup can be emphasizing {hardware} merchandise.

Chesky additionally received’t be going into “founder mode” at this operation; an individual accustomed to the scenario says he’ll stay as Airbnb’s CEO and never lead the brand new lab himself. Whoever will get the job should contend not solely with the opposite AI labs, but additionally with a founding chair (we presume) referred to as a micromanager.

A consultant for Airbnb and Chesky declined to remark.
